Yardım AutoPickup "Could not pass event EntityDeathEvent" Sorunu

Caner07ant

Marangoz
En iyi cevaplar
0
Oyun Sürümü
PaperSpigot 1.8.8
Selamun aleyküm arkadaşlar merhabalar,
AutoPickup plugininde ayarlamalarım ve permlerim doğru bi şekilde verildiği halde
Bu hatayı alıyorum yanan bir iron golemi öldürdüğümde geliyor bu hata
fakat normal hayvan falan öldürünce error vermiyor
ve sadece lavda yanan iron golem öldürünce bu error geliyor bazen vermiyor bazen veriyor error'u
çoğunlukla vermekte, başka bir kaç yanan hayvan denedim error vermedi

ve iron golem için bir skript kullanıyorum düşünce çiçek vermemesi için olan bir skript farkettim
ki bu skripti kapatınca error vermiyor çözümü olan varmıdır?

JavaScript:
on death of a iron golem:
    remove all red roses from the drops


verdiğim perm:
autopickup.enabled
ALDIĞIM ERROR

JavaScript:
Could not pass event EntityDeathEvent to AutoPickup v3.9
org.bukkit.event.EventException
    at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.java:302) -[M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at co.aikar.timings.TimedEventExecutor.execute(TimedEventExecutor.java:78) -[M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.java:62) -[M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at org.bukkit.plugin.SimplePluginManager.fireEvent(SimplePluginManager.java:517)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.java:502)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at org.bukkit.craftbukkit.v1_8_R3.event.CraftEventFactory.callEntityDeathEvent(CraftEventFactory.java:378)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.EntityLiving.die(EntityLiving.java:884)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.EntityIronGolem.die(EntityIronGolem.java:182)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.EntityLiving.damageEntity(EntityLiving.java:822)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.EntityHuman.attack(EntityHuman.java:1002)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.EntityPlayer.attack(EntityPlayer.java:1086)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.PlayerConnection.a(PlayerConnection.java:1382)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.PacketPlayInUseEntity.a(SourceFile:52)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.PacketPlayInUseEntity.a(SourceFile:11)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.PlayerConnectionUtils$1.run(SourceFile:13)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at java.util.concurrent.Executors$RunnableAdapter.call(Unknown Source) [?:1.8.0_231]
    at java.util.concurrent.FutureTask.run(Unknown Source) [?:1.8.0_231]
    at net.minecraft.server.v1_8_R3.SystemUtils.a(SourceFile:44)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.MinecraftServer.B(MinecraftServer.java:774)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.DedicatedServer.B(DedicatedServer.java:378)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.MinecraftServer.A(MinecraftServer.java:713)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at net.minecraft.server.v1_8_R3.MinecraftServer.run(MinecraftServer.java:616) [M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at java.lang.Thread.run(Unknown Source) [?:1.8.0_231]
Caused by: java.lang.IllegalArgumentException: Item cannot be null
    at org.apache.commons.lang.Validate.noNullElements(Validate.java:364) -[M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at org.bukkit.craftbukkit.v1_8_R3.inventory.CraftInventory.addItem(CraftInventory.java:265) -[M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    at me.MnMaxon.AutoPickup.MainListener.onKill(MainListener.java:185) -[?:?]
    at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) -[?:1.8.0_231]
    at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source) -[?:1.8.0_231]
    at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source) -[?:1.8.0_231]
    at java.lang.reflect.Method.invoke(Unknown Source) -[?:1.8.0_231]
    at org.bukkit.plugin.java.JavaPluginLoader$1.execute(JavaPluginLoader.java:300) -[MassiveNW.jar:git-PaperSpigot-"4c7641d"]
    ... 22 more
 
Son düzenleme:

EmirHUB

Ağaç Yumruklayıcı
En iyi cevaplar
1
Normalde gülü alıyor mu bilmiyorum ama Item cannot be null hata olarak bunu veriyor itemin null olamayacağından bahediyor büyük ihtimal sen onu silince plugin boşluğu alamıyacağı için hataya sebep veriyor.

Tabi dediğim gibi gülü almıyorsa benimde fikrim açıkcası yok
 

Caner07ant

Marangoz
En iyi cevaplar
0
Normalde gülü alıyor mu bilmiyorum ama Item cannot be null hata olarak bunu veriyor itemin null olamayacağından bahediyor büyük ihtimal sen onu silince plugin boşluğu alamıyacağı için hataya sebep veriyor.

Tabi dediğim gibi gülü almıyorsa benimde fikrim açıkcası yok
Skript aktif olduğunda autopickup ve gül silme skripti sıkıntısız çalışıyor fakat error veriyor
 
Üst